Web automation tools are invaluable for improving productivity, saving time, and automating repetitive tasks online. Whether you are managing multiple accounts, performing web scraping, or simply automating processes to increase efficiency, residential RDP (Remote Desktop Protocol) provides a secure and reliable environment for running these tools. Residential RDP allows you to access the internet from an IP address that appears to come from a regular household connection, which is less likely to be flagged or blocked by websites.
In this article, we will guide you through the process of setting up web automation tools in Residential RDP and how you can leverage this powerful combination to optimize your online operations. This guide is aimed at beginners and will help you get started with web automation clearly and simply.
What is Residential RDP?
Residential RDP is a service that provides remote desktop access to a computer or virtual machine with an IP address tied to a residential area. Unlike traditional data center IPs, residential IPs are harder to detect and block because they mimic normal internet traffic from home users. By using Residential RDP, you can ensure that your browsing activity appears legitimate and avoid detection by websites that may restrict automated activity.
This makes Residential RDP a valuable tool for running web automation tasks such as:
-
Managing multiple accounts on social media or e-commerce platforms
-
Web scraping and data collection
-
Automating content uploads and interactions
-
Completing online surveys or tasks across different websites
Why Use Residential RDP for Web Automation?
Residential RDP offers several key benefits for web automation:
-
Avoid Detection: Websites are less likely to block or restrict access from a residential IP address. This is particularly useful when running automated tools that may trigger anti-bot systems.
-
Multiple Account Management: Residential RDP enables you to manage multiple accounts on the same website without triggering suspicion. By using unique residential IPs for each account, you can run automation for different profiles without linking them together.
-
Bypass Geo-Restrictions: If you need to automate tasks on websites with geographic restrictions or localized content, Residential RDP allows you to connect from various locations around the world, making it easier to access different versions of a site.
-
Enhanced Security: Residential RDP provides a secure, encrypted connection to the internet, ensuring that your data remains private and protected from potential threats.
How to Set Up Web Automation Tools in Residential RDP
Setting up web automation tools in Residential RDP involves a few key steps. Below is a simple, step-by-step guide to help you get started:
Choose a Reliable Residential RDP Provider
Before you can begin using web automation tools, you need to choose a Residential RDP provider. Some popular options include:
-
Shifter
-
Bright Data (formerly Luminati)
-
Smartproxy
-
ProxyRack
These providers offer varying plans with access to different regions and IP pools. When choosing a provider, consider the following factors:
-
IP Pool Size: Ensure the provider offers a large number of residential IPs for diverse geographic locations.
-
Connection Speed and Stability: Choose a provider known for reliable, fast connections, which are essential for automation tasks.
-
Security Features: Make sure the provider uses strong encryption and offers secure login options to protect your data.
Set Up the Residential RDP
After selecting a Residential RDP provider, sign up for a plan that suits your needs and follow the provider’s instructions to set up your remote desktop connection.
-
Install RDP Software: If you don’t already have an RDP client installed on your computer, you will need to download and install one. Some common RDP software includes:
-
Microsoft Remote Desktop (for Windows)
-
Chrome Remote Desktop (for both Windows and Mac)
-
Remote Desktop Manager (for Windows and macOS)
-
-
Connect to the Residential IP: Once the RDP client is set up, use the credentials provided by your Residential RDP provider to log in. You will be assigned a remote desktop with a residential IP address, ensuring that your activity appears like it is coming from a normal household connection.
Install Web Automation Tools
Web automation tools can automate a wide range of tasks, from filling out forms to interacting with websites. Some popular web automation tools include:
-
Selenium: Selenium is one of the most commonly used tools for automating web browsers. It allows you to simulate user interactions such as clicks, form submissions, and page navigation.
-
Puppeteer: Puppeteer is another web automation tool designed specifically for headless browsing (browsing without the graphical interface). It is commonly used for tasks like web scraping, testing, and automation.
-
AutoHotkey: This powerful scripting language allows you to automate tasks on your computer, including browser actions and mouse movements.
-
UI.Vision RPA: This tool provides a more visual approach to automation, allowing you to automate repetitive tasks on web pages.
To install one of these tools:
-
Download and Install the Tool: Follow the installation instructions for your chosen automation tool. For example, you can install Selenium or Puppeteer via the terminal or command prompt using Node.js or Python.
-
Configure the Tool: Once installed, configure the tool by defining the tasks you want to automate. For example, you can write a script using Selenium to log into a website, fill out forms, and scrape data.
Set Up Automation Tasks
With the Residential RDP and web automation tool in place, it’s time to configure the automation tasks you want to perform. These could include tasks such as:
-
Managing Multiple Accounts: Use automation tools to log into different accounts on the same website while ensuring that each account uses a unique residential IP address. This can help you avoid getting flagged for suspicious activity.
-
Web Scraping: Set up your automation tool to crawl websites and collect data such as product listings, reviews, or prices.
-
Content Posting: Automate content uploads or interaction with users on social media platforms or e-commerce sites like Amazon or eBay.
-
Form Filling: Automate tasks like filling out online forms, completing surveys, or posting comments across multiple websites.
Monitor and Adjust Automation
Once your web automation tasks are running, it is essential to monitor their performance and make adjustments as necessary. Some common adjustments include:
-
Changing IPs: Rotate your residential IPs regularly to avoid detection by websites and ensure that your activities remain anonymous.
-
Adjusting Automation Scripts: As websites change, you may need to modify your automation scripts to account for new page elements or features.
Best Practices for Using Web Automation Tools in Residential RDP
-
Use Proxies When Necessary: For added security, you may want to use proxies in conjunction with Residential RDP to rotate IP addresses frequently and avoid detection.
-
Limit Requests: Avoid making too many requests in a short period. This could trigger rate-limiting or anti-bot protections. Set your automation tools to mimic natural browsing behavior.
-
Monitor Your Activity: Regularly check the progress of your automation tasks to ensure that they are running smoothly and have not triggered any alerts or bans.
-
Respect Website Terms of Service: Always ensure that your automated actions comply with the terms and conditions of the websites you interact with to avoid legal or account-related issues.
Frequently Asked Questions (FAQ)
What is the difference between Residential RDP and regular RDP? Residential RDP uses an IP address tied to a residential area, making it harder to detect and block compared to regular RDP, which typically uses data center IP addresses. Residential IPs are trusted more by websites, reducing the likelihood of being flagged or blocked.
Can I use web automation tools for social media management on Residential RDP? Yes, Residential RDP is ideal for managing multiple social media accounts and automating actions like posting, liking, or commenting. By using unique residential IPs for each account, you can avoid triggering suspicion or account bans.
Is it safe to use web automation tools in Residential RDP? Yes, using Residential RDP with web automation tools is generally safe, as long as you respect the terms of service of the websites you are interacting with and avoid engaging in malicious activity.
How do I rotate IPs while using Residential RDP? Some Residential RDP providers offer automatic IP rotation as part of their service. Alternatively, you can manually select different IPs for each session or use proxy rotation tools in combination with your RDP connection.
Can I use Residential RDP for web scraping? Yes, Residential RDP is ideal for web scraping tasks, as it allows you to appear as a legitimate user from a residential IP address. This reduces the chances of being blocked by websites for scraping data.
For more information and tips on web automation and Residential RDP, visit Rossetaltd.com.
Português